DIY Foot Scrub Recipe

I hate dry and scaly feet. If you’re one with me who hates rough feet then let’s spa-mper our feet together with the DIY (do it yourself) Foot Scrub Recipe I have here. To do this home-made foot scrub recipe, you need the following:
  •  Lemon grass
  • 1 cup of warm water
  • 10 candlenuts

Procedure:

Infuse the lemongrass in the warm water. Squash the candlenuts in a bowl to form a paste. Slowly combine the infusion with the paste to create a coarse lotion. Using deep, circular movements, massage into feet the home-made foot scrub. Then rinse off your feet with cold water.

Presto! You’ll feel the deference of your feet after doing this. The rough feet are now soft and hydrated.
